在快節奏的量化交易世界中,每一毫秒都很重要。無論您是執行高頻策略還是對歷史數據運行複雜的回溯測試,您的交易表現在很大程度上取決於作系統 (OS) 的效率 、穩定性和速度 。這不再只是硬體的問題,您選擇的作系統可能是交易獲勝還是錯失機會之間的區別。
量化交易者依靠高性能軟體和數據管道來做出閃電般的決策。這意味著作系統必須支援交易平臺、低延遲網路、繁重的計算任務和可靠的安全協定。在本文中,我們將探討量化交易的最佳作系統,分解它們的優缺點,並提供提示以説明交易者充分利用他們的設置。
作系統在量化交易中的重要性
量化交易涉及處理大型數據集、執行實時市場分析和運行複雜的演算法。作系統在確保所有這一切無縫發生方面發揮著至關重要的作用。它影響從延遲和穩定性到軟體相容性和安全性的方方面面。
一些交易者優先考慮 定製和速度,而另一些交易者則專注於 使用者介面和生態系統相容性。選擇正確的作系統不僅僅是關於偏好,而是使您的平臺與您的交易目標和技術要求保持一致。
量化交易者的最佳作系統
Windows 是交易者中使用最廣泛的作系統之一,主要是因為它與 MetaTrader、TradeStation 和 Bloomberg Terminal 等主要交易平臺和金融軟體相容。它還支援多種開發工具,使其成為全權委託和量化交易者的靈活選擇。但是,與更簡化的系統相比,它在定製和低延遲性能方面可能達不到要求。
優點:
- 與交易應用程式和 API 的廣泛相容性
- 使用者友好,提供強大的支援和定期更新
- 非常適合基於 GUI 的交易平臺和 Excel 集成
缺點:
- 更高的系統開銷和更多的後台進程
- 容易受到系統膨脹和偶爾更新的影響,從而導致不穩定
macOS 受到重視設計、穩定性和生態系統集成的交易者的青睞。它在喜歡精美UI和可靠性能的投資組合經理和長期投資者中特別受歡迎。雖然macOS為大多數用例提供了良好的性能,但它對於低延遲交易和某些僅在Windows或Linux上可用的交易平台來說有些限制。
優點:
- 通過直觀的介面穩定安全
- 非常適合回溯測試、Python/R 開發和投資組合分析
- 與 Apple 的生態系統無縫集成
缺點:
- 對流行的交易工具和平台的支援有限
- 對於高級定量工作流程來說,可定製性較低
Linux,尤其是Ubuntu、Debian或CentOS等發行版,是 認真的量化交易者和開發人員的首選作系統。它提供了一個輕量級、可定製的環境,非常適合 低延遲交易、 演算法執行和 基於伺服器的策略。由於其靈活性、安全性和性能,大多數機構交易系統和專有平臺都建立在Linux上。
優點:
- 高度可定製和性能優化
- 通過更好的記憶體管理降低系統開銷
- 非常適合自動化、HFT 以及在 VPS 或雲環境中運行
缺點:
- 新用戶的學習曲線更陡峭
- 對主流交易平臺的有限開箱即用支援
如何最大限度地提高作系統性能進行交易
無論您選擇哪種作系統,每個量化交易者都應該遵循一些最佳實踐,以充分利用他們的設置:
- 保持最新狀態:定期更新您的作系統和交易軟體可確保安全性和性能改進。
- 限制後台進程:禁用不必要的啟動程式和服務以減少延遲。
- 高效的存儲管理:使用 SSD 實現更快的數據訪問,並組織您的文件系統以實現最佳性能。
- 輕量級防病毒解決方案:選擇高效的安全工具,在不降低系統速度的情況下提供保護。
結論
在選擇量化交易作系統時,沒有萬能的解決方案。最好的作系統取決於您的交易風格、技術技能和性能要求。
- 在靈活性和平臺相容性方面, Windows 是一個可靠的多面手。
- 為了獲得直觀的設計和穩定的性能, macOS 非常適合投資組合級分析。
- 在速度、定製和可擴充性方面, Linux 是高級量化和演算法交易者的首選。
如果您像 Algoter 這樣的公司一樣,專注於性能、可擴展性和構建高頻或 AI 增強戰略,那麼投資於精簡、優化的 Linux 環境可以在當今競爭激烈的市場中為您提供關鍵優勢。無論您選擇什麼,正確的作系統都將增強您的交易基礎設施,並提高您在 2025 年數位交易環境中的整體優勢。